Synthesis and characterization of superconducting polycrystalline La2-xSrxCuO4-δ
Abstract
Superconducting bulk La2-xSrxCuO4 with doping concentration x = 0, 0.14, 0.16, 0.18 and 0.20 were synthesized via solid state reaction technique. X-ray diffraction data, SEM images and AC magnetic susceptibility were used to study the grain morphology, crystal properties and superconductivity of the samples. Results indicate effective Sr doping on the samples. The critical temperature of the samples is lower than the maximum Tc of 38K due to annealing in ambient atmosphere
